Learning and Assessment in Postmodern Education

2003, Educational Theory

https://doi.org/10.1111/J.1741-5446.2003.00313.X

Abstract
sparkles

AI

This essay explores the concepts of learning and assessment in the context of postmodern education, examining the ambivalence surrounding these notions as either playful relativism or focused local competence. Drawing on Wittgensteinian language games and the philosophy of Hannah Arendt, the work proposes a circular understanding of education that integrates both learning and assessment.
